Wellness in the Workplace: A Guide to Creating a Healthy and Happy Work Environment
Introduction
As the modern workplace continues to evolve, so too must the way we approach employee wellness. With the rise of sedentary jobs and long working hours, the need for workplace wellness programs has never been more pressing. But what exactly does it mean to have a healthy and happy work environment? In this guide, we’ll explore the importance of workplace wellness and provide you with practical tips and strategies to create a thriving work environment that benefits both employees and employers alike.
The Importance of Workplace Wellness
Workplace wellness is more than just providing a healthy snack machine or a gym membership. It’s about creating a culture that prioritizes employee well-being, promotes job satisfaction, and increases productivity. When employees are healthy and happy, they’re more likely to be engaged, motivated, and committed to their work. This, in turn, leads to increased job satisfaction, reduced turnover rates, and improved employee retention.
Benefits of Workplace Wellness
- Improved employee morale and job satisfaction
- Reduced absenteeism and turnover rates
- Increased productivity and efficiency
- Better employee health and well-being
Creating a Healthy and Happy Work Environment
So, how can you create a healthy and happy work environment? Here are some practical tips and strategies to get you started:
Provide a Healthy Work-Life Balance
Encourage employees to take breaks, work flexible hours, and prioritize self-care. This can include offering on-site fitness classes, meditation sessions, or simply designating quiet areas for employees to take a few minutes to themselves.
Foster Open Communication
Encourage open and honest communication between employees, managers, and HR. This can be done through regular check-ins, anonymous feedback forms, or simply by creating a safe and inclusive environment where employees feel comfortable speaking up.
Offer Wellness Initiatives
Provide employees with access to wellness initiatives such as health coaching, mental health resources, or employee assistance programs. These can be provided in-house or through partnerships with local wellness providers.
Promote Work-Life Balance
Encourage employees to prioritize their personal and family responsibilities. This can be done by offering flexible scheduling, telecommuting options, or simply by being understanding of employees’ needs.

FAQs
Q: What are some common wellness initiatives provided by companies?
A: Some common wellness initiatives provided by companies include employee fitness classes, mental health resources, employee assistance programs, and on-site fitness centers.
Q: What are some ways to promote work-life balance?
A: Some ways to promote work-life balance include flexible scheduling, telecommuting options, and encouraging employees to take breaks and prioritize self-care.
Q: How can I measure the effectiveness of my workplace wellness program?
A: You can measure the effectiveness of your workplace wellness program by tracking employee engagement, absenteeism and turnover rates, and employee satisfaction and well-being surveys.
